section .data
msg db 'Valor de rcx: ', 0
section .bss
num resb 2 ; Reservando 2 bytes para armazenar o valor convertido (para valores de 0 a 9)
section .text
global _start
_start:
mov rax, 5 ; Move o valor 5 para o registrador rax
mov rbx, 3 ; Move o valor 3 para o registrador rbx
cmp rax, rbx ; Compara rax com rbx
jz iguais ; Se rax for igual a rbx, salta para "iguais"
mov rcx, 9 ; Se não forem iguais, move o valor 9 para rcx
jmp fim ; Salta para o rótulo "fim"
iguais:
mov rcx, 0 ; Se forem iguais, move 0 para rcx
fim:
; Imprimir a mensagem
mov rax, 1 ; Número da chamada do sistema para escrever
mov rdi, 1 ; Identificador de saída padrão (stdout)
mov rsi, msg ; Endereço da mensagem
mov rdx, 14 ; Tamanho da mensagem
syscall ; Chama o sistema para escrever
; Converter rcx (valor entre 0 e 9) para caractere ASCII e armazenar em 'num'
add rcx, '0' ; Converte o número para o caractere ASCII correspondente
mov [num], rcx ; Armazena o caractere convertido no buffer 'num'
; Imprimir o valor de rcx como caractere (agora armazenado em 'num')
mov rax, 1 ; Número da chamada do sistema para escrever
mov rdi, 1 ; Identificador de saída padrão (stdout)
mov rsi, num ; Endereço do valor convertido em 'num'
mov rdx, 1 ; Comprimento de 1 byte
syscall ; Chama o sistema para escrever
; Finaliza o programa
mov rax, 60 ; Número da chamada do sistema para sair
xor rdi, rdi ; Código de saída 0
syscall ; Chama o sistema para sair
